According to the cryptocurrency spring report released by Chainalysis, the adoption rate and market importance of stablecoins will increase rapidly in 2024. The number of addresses holding stablecoins and their use in on-chain transactions will greatly increase, making them a global financial asset. Legislative work in the United States, such as the Lummis-Gillibrand Payment Stablecoin Act, aims to establish a regulatory framework for stablecoins by providing safer and clearer guidance for their use, enhancing people's confidence, and encouraging further adoption of stablecoins. The global demand for stablecoins, especially those pegged to the US dollar, highlights their role in financial inclusion and as a bridge between traditional finance and cryptocurrency, despite ongoing discussions about their regulation.
